Is hiring a local Utah app agency more expensive than offshore?+
Not when you count total cost. Offshore hourly rates of $25–60/hr look attractive but routinely run 40–70% over estimate due to timezone delays, QA gaps, and rework cycles. AppsTango's fixed-price packages (from $10k) lock the scope and cost upfront. A $15k AppsTango MVP often beats a $10k offshore engagement that ran to $18k after two rounds of revision.
What are the biggest risks of offshore app development?+
The five most common failure modes: (1) timezone friction that turns one-hour decisions into one-day blockers; (2) bait-and-switch staffing — senior sold, junior billed; (3) code held in offshore accounts until final payment; (4) unenforceable contracts when things go wrong; (5) App Store / Play Store unfamiliarity leading to rejections. Can offshore teams build quality iOS and Android apps?+
Some can. The challenge is verification before you sign. App Store and Play Store submission experience, Swift/Kotlin expertise, and performance benchmarks are hard to verify from a proposal. Why does AppsTango recommend local Utah hiring for most projects?+
For projects with any real-time collaboration requirement — design reviews, stakeholder demos, rapid iteration — timezone alignment is worth more than the rate differential. For pure backend work with stable requirements, offshore can work. But most meaningful software products involve changing requirements, which makes async-first offshore development structurally inefficient.
